Goldman Sachs's SBIO Position: Q2 2026 in Review

Goldman Sachs sold out of ALPS Medical Breakthroughs ETF (SBIO) in Q2 2026, closing a stake of 8,904 shares — an estimated $466K sold.

Goldman Sachs first reported a position in SBIO in Q2 2016 and held it in 5 quarters. The position peaked at $1.31M in Q3 2016. 66 funds tracked by Wall St. Rank hold SBIO as of Q2 2026.
